Use the table to answer the question. x y 4 38 6 58 Write the equation of the linear function that models the relationship shown in the table. (1 point) Responses y=10x−2 y equals 10 x minus 2 y=10x+2 y equals 10 x plus 2 y=x+34 y equals x plus 34 y=−10x+78

To find the equation of the linear function, we need to determine the slope using the two points given in the table.

Slope (m) = (change in y) / (change in x)
Slope = (58 - 38) / (6 - 4)
Slope = 20 / 2
Slope = 10

Now, we choose one point from the table to substitute into the general form of a linear equation y = mx + b to solve for the y-intercept (b).

Using the point (4, 38):
38 = 10(4) + b
38 = 40 + b
b = 38 - 40
b = -2

Therefore, the equation of the linear function is y = 10x - 2.
